“Me olvidé de mis ojos” by , on view at the CAB in Burgos, Spain, through June, curated by Javier del Campo.
In this project, Ercole approaches landscape as a space where identity, memory, and culture intersect. Through drawing, he reveals invisible structures inherent to both place and remembrance, creating visual environments that seem to expand, contract, and transform before the viewer’s eyes.
Rather than depicting a specific location, the works investigate the conditions through which we imagine, construct, and inhabit landscapes. The exhibition unfolds as a field of tensions where the emotional, the symbolic, and the plausible coexist, inviting new ways of seeing and experiencing space.
